Yeah in the past few years the only in-house TBS star guys doing much for Oregon have been Franklin and Conerly, and now DJU's younger brother and the rest have just been portal guys and try hard guys the TBS dudes didn't actually want. They're not the only ones doing it though. Texas, Ohio State, and others have relied plenty on the portal. It's great for them because you can easily make up for lack of development by buying players other schools developed. If you have enough money to blast it for the best portal guys you never have to rebuild unless you're really bad at it like USC.
UW and all the schools down the line pretty much do the same thing now but I think the variance in development importance and how good guys are coming out the portal is a way way way more top heavy favored than it is coming out of high school.
